Abstract

We live a new social paradigm named network society, where information circulates intensely through networks mediated by technology. The lifestyles made possible by this new social organization also determine access to knowledge and the reconfiguration of relational processes, which brings us to great challenges, but also opportunities to learn and better evolve responding to our personal or professional needs. Thus, it empowers us in access to knowledge and integrates us into an online participatory culture. In this context, it is essential to consider new paths for learning, diferente and innovatives that respond to the needs of individuals along their lives. We assume, then, the purpose of this essay to reflect on Open Educational Resources and Open Education in the context of new lifestyles, that is, in today's network society, exploring how new needs to learn intersect the social dynamics made possible by online life.
